
17cÍøÒ³°æ employees have been moving more, sitting less and feeling better! The university competed against 84 employers and 78,075 participants across the country in the Wellness Council of America’s On The Move Challenge, a 12-week (April 4–June 26) national corporate fitness competition promoting more movement throughout the workday.
Each week 17cÍøÒ³°æâ€™s 1,148 registered participants had the opportunity to learn more about the benefits of physical activity, assess their progress, share successes and goals with others, boost peers for bonus points and, of course, move!
At the end of the challenge, 17cÍøÒ³°æâ€™s team ranked 29 of 56 companies in its category. Employees on all 17cÍøÒ³°æ campuses worked together to contribute to the team’s national ranking, including the On the Move group at 17cÍøÒ³°æ at Ashtabula (see photo).
Says Teresa Bates, On the Move coordinator for 17cÍøÒ³°æ Ashtabula: “It was great to participate in a corporate challenge that gave us the opportunity to both compete and build comradery.â€
After the summer issue of 17cÍøÒ³°æ Magazine went to press, we learned that 17cÍøÒ³°æ earned a Top 50 Most Active Employers Honor for our participation in the On The Move Challenge.
